
While the term bungalow is used generously around Ubud's accommodation, for our purposes they will be rental homes with at least a bedroom, bathroom, and small kitchen. Most share property with other bungalows in a private garden area, and other amenities may include swimming pool, stunning views, or central locations. Less expensive than villas and hotels, this is a great solution for the budget traveler. Home-stays were originally termed to refer to accommodation within a Balinese home. While that rule still applies today, it is best described as a small, comfortable, and extremely affordable room within the center of Ubud. You will get a bedroom, bathroom, and usually breakfast in the morning prepared by the women of the household. It is not only a great insight into Balinese living, but easy on the pocketbook too.

What to expect
Price range of bungalows can usually be divided into these two categories. Have a look at what you can expect for your money.
| Price range (per night) | What to expect |
|---|---|
USD $10 - $20Basic standard |
Large selection of home-stays, guesthouses or inexpensive bungalows. Expect a small, plain room with a bed, bed stand, fan, closet, cold shower in varying standards of freshness, simple or even shared bathroom. Breakfasts are usually included. Don't expect Wifi, swimming pool, or a view, though some may be surrounded by rice fields. Most guesthouses occupy an area within a Balinese compound, which may be a great way to learn more about local culture. |
USD $20 - $30Good standard |
For just a little bit more you can get a surprisingly good place to stay. Accommodation within this range is usually a cottage, small house or bungalow with a nicely decorated room, simple bathroom, fan hot and cold shower and sometimes even a swimming pool. Most places within this category have a rice field or river view. Breakfast is included. Wifi is rare. |
